The Infante Carlos Luis de Borbón y Braganza, Conde de Montémolin (1818-1861) was the Carlist claimant to the throne of Spain under the name Carlos VI, after the abdication of his father in 1845.

Carlos was born at the Royal Palace in Madrid on 31 January 1818, the elder son of Infante Don Carlos Maria Isidro. On 10 July 1850, he married Maria Carolina of the Two Sicilies, fifth daughter of Francis I of the Two Sicilies. They had no children.

In 1860, during a Carlist rising, he and his brother Infante Don Fernando were taken prisoners at San Carlos de la Rápita. Although they were later released, in 1861, suddenly and unexpected, Carlos Luis, his wife Maria Carolina, and his brother Fernando died, for reasons not fully explained. The three are buried at Trieste, in the chapel of Saint Charles Borromeo in the Basilica di San Giusto. Don Carlos Luis was succeeded as Carlist claimant by another brother, Juan, Count of Montizón.
